Intel Xeon E5-2620 V3 Civilization V Benchmarks - Can Xeon E5-2620 V3 Run Civilization V?

High-end Server processor released in 2014 with 6 cores and 12 threads. With base clock at 2.4GHz, max speed at 3.2GHz, and a 85W power rating. Xeon E5-2620 V3 is based on the Haswell-EP 22nm family and part of the Xeon E5 series.
